  • Episode 336: Preview of the 29th. annual International Festival of Celtic Colours (October 10 to 18, 2025).
    Oct 10 2025

    Send us a text

    Featuring the 29th. International Festival of Celtic Colours - A preview/showcase of celtic music and community events throughout Cape Breton Nova Scotia, from October 10 – 18, 2025. Sounds Atlantic host Ron Moores previews this annual celtic music festival, including an overview and sample of concerts at over 40 venues with 150 artists, along with over 200 community events scheduled throughout Cape Breton.

  • Episode 335: New Brunswick Singer-songwriter Robert Jones
    Oct 3 2025

    Send us a text

    Featuring music from New Brunswick’s acclaimed singer-songwriter Robert Thomas. A celebrated New Brunswick artist known for his exceptional songwriting and energetic performances alongside his band, the sessionmen (Ray Legere and Jon Arsenault), his deeply personal and universally relatable songs, combined with impeccable musical talent, make for an unforgettable and entertaining experience for audiences”.

    His songs have been covered by the “The Dixie Chicks” and Bonnie Raitt and his music is firmly rooted in the Americana and Folk genres, often incorporating elements of bluegrass. Thomas's performances are a balance of humor, heart, and a genuine connection with his audience.

  • Episode 333: Remembering American Cousin James King
    Sep 5 2025

    Send us a text

    “American Cousin” James King will always be remembered as one of the great traditional bluegrass vocalists, leaving a legacy of excellent music. His work with the bluegrass super group Longview produced some of the best traditional bluegrass in recent decades and his last album, 2013’s “Three Chords and the Truth”, received a Grammy nomination for Best Bluegrass Album. In September 2014, he was inducted into the Virginia Country Music Hall of Fame.
